Gitlab Hosting

Stellen Sie eine vollständige DevOps-Plattform auf der leistungsstarken Cloud-Infrastruktur von Kamatera bereit.

GitLab ist eine umfassende DevOps-Plattform, die Versionskontrolle, CI/CD, Sicherheitsprüfungen, Projektmanagement und Deployment in einer einzigen Anwendung vereint. GitLab bietet alles von der Fehlerverfolgung über Versionskontrolle und CI/CD bis hin zu Sicherheitsprüfungen und Deployment – ​​alles in einer integrierten Anwendung. Ihr gesamter Softwareentwicklungszyklus ist zentralisiert, mit einem einheitlichen Berechtigungsmodell, einer einheitlichen Benutzeroberfläche und einer zentralen Datenquelle.

 

Mit GitLab VPS-Hosting auf der leistungsstarken Cloud-Infrastruktur von Kamatera profitieren Sie von der Geschwindigkeit und Kontrolle, die für schnelle Builds, Datenschutz und reibungslose Deployments sorgt.

GitLab DE
  • Die NVMe-SSDs von Kamatera sind deutlich schneller als herkömmliche SSDs, sodass die GitLab-Benutzeroberfläche reaktionsschnell bleibt und Hintergrundaufgaben ohne Engpässe ausgeführt werden können.
  • Mit einem GitLab-VPS legen Sie die Regeln fest. Ihr geistiges Eigentum bleibt auf einem privaten Server unter Ihrer Kontrolle, in einem Rechenzentrum Ihrer Wahl.
  • Auch wenn Ihr Team von fünf Entwicklern auf fünfhundert wächst, bleiben Ihre Infrastrukturkosten dank der flexiblen Skalierungslösungen von Kamatera vorhersehbar und überschaubar.
  • Kamatera stellt dedizierte CPU- und RAM-Ressourcen bereit. Dadurch wird sichergestellt, dass ein ressourcenintensiver Build-Prozess auf dem Konto eines anderen Benutzers Ihre geschäftskritischen Merge-Anfragen niemals verlangsamt.

Price Calculator

+ Speicher hinzufügen

Zusätzlicher Datenverkehr kostet nur 0,01$ pro GB
Zusätzlicher Speicher kostet nur 0,05$ pro GB und Monat
Die Abrechnung der Server erfolgt minutengenau

$12,00 /Stunde

Rechenzentren auf der ganzen Welt

Sind Sie bereit? 30 Tage kostenlos testen. Loslegen

Häufig gestellte fragen

Was ist GitLab hosting?

GitLab-Hosting bezeichnet den Betrieb von GitLab – einer vollständigen DevOps-Plattform – auf einer Serverinfrastruktur, auf der Sie Ihren Softwareentwicklungszyklus verwalten können. Durch die Selbstverwaltung von GitLab auf einem privaten Server erhalten Sie die volle Kontrolle über Ihr geistiges Eigentum und Ihre sensiblen API-Schlüssel, die sich auf einer privaten, isolierten Instanz befinden. Dieser Ansatz beseitigt die Nachteile nutzerbasierter Lizenzierung und strenger CI/CD-Minutenbegrenzungen.

In der Performance liegt die Stärke dieser Lösung, insbesondere dank der NVMe-basierten Architektur von Kamatera. GitLab ist eine ressourcenintensive Suite, die stark auf schnelle Festplatten-E/A für Datenbankabfragen, Repository-Indexierung und Container-Registry-Operationen angewiesen ist. Durch den Einsatz dedizierter Intel Xeon-Prozessoren und Hochgeschwindigkeitsspeicher stellt Kamatera sicher, dass umfangreiche CI/CD-Pipelines und komplexe Merge Requests mit maximaler Geschwindigkeit verarbeitet werden. Dies reduziert Entwickler-Ausfallzeiten und beschleunigt Ihre Markteinführung.

GitLab-VPS-Hosting bietet die unübertroffene Flexibilität, die für langfristiges Wachstum erforderlich ist. Im Gegensatz zu statischen SaaS-Angeboten ermöglicht Kamatera die vertikale Skalierung Ihrer Serverressourcen innerhalb von Sekunden, beispielsweise durch Hinzufügen von mehr RAM für wachsende Anwendungen. Ob Sie nun eine große Nutzerbasis haben oder den Speicherplatz für eine umfangreiche Container-Registry erweitern möchten – Sie haben die Freiheit, Ihre bevorzugte Linux-Distribution und Sicherheitskonfigurationen auszuwählen.

Was sind die Serveranforderungen für den Betrieb von GitLab?

Für GitLab gelten bestimmte Installationsanforderungen. Hier ein kurzer Überblick:

CPU
Die CPU-Anforderungen hängen von der Anzahl der Benutzer und der erwarteten Auslastung ab. Die Auslastung umfasst die Aktivitäten Ihrer Benutzer, die Verwendung von Automatisierung und Spiegelung sowie die Größe des Repositorys. Für maximal 20 Anfragen pro Sekunde oder 1.000 Benutzer sollten Sie über 8 vCPU verfügen.

Speicherplatz
Der erforderliche Speicherplatz hängt weitgehend von der Größe der Repositorys ab, die Sie in GitLab haben möchten. Als Richtlinie sollten Sie mindestens so viel freien Speicherplatz haben, wie alle Ihre Repositorys zusammen benötigen.
Das Linux-Paket benötigt etwa 2,5 GB Speicherplatz für die Installation.

Arbeitsspeicher
Die Anforderungen an den Arbeitsspeicher hängen von der Anzahl der Benutzer und der erwarteten Auslastung ab. Die Auslastung umfasst die Aktivitäten Ihrer Benutzer, die Verwendung von Automatisierung und Spiegelung sowie die Größe des Repositorys. Für maximal 20 Anfragen pro Sekunde oder 1.000 Benutzer sollten Sie über 16 GB Arbeitsspeicher verfügen.

Weitere Informationen finden Sie in den Installationsanforderungen für Gitlab.

Was passiert, wenn ich mehr Speicherplatz für meine Gitlab-Repositories benötige?

Kamatera ermöglicht eine einfache Speichererweiterung. Wenn Ihre Repositories oder Ihre Container-Registry schneller wachsen als erwartet, können Sie über das Dashboard zusätzlichen Blockspeicher hinzufügen oder die Größe Ihrer primären Festplatte sofort erhöhen, ohne Daten zu verlieren.

Welchen Nutzen bietet ein NVMe-Speicher für meinen GitLab VPS?

GitLab benötigt viele Datenbanken und Festplatten. Jedes Mal, wenn ein Entwickler Code hochlädt, eine Pipeline ausführt oder auf die Container-Registry zugreift, führt der Server umfangreiche E/A-Operationen durch. Die NVMe-SSDs von Kamatera sind deutlich schneller als herkömmliche SSDs und sorgen so für eine flüssige GitLab-Benutzeroberfläche und reibungslose Hintergrundprozesse.

Welche Optionen für Datensicherung und Notfallwiederherstellung gibt es?

GitLab bietet umfassende Backup- und Wiederherstellungsfunktionen, die für den Schutz Ihrer Entwicklungsinfrastruktur unerlässlich sind. Das integrierte Backup-Tool erstellt vollständige Backups, einschließlich Repositories, Datenbank, Konfiguration, Artefakte, Uploads und Container-Registrierungsdaten. Die Backup-Services von Kamatera, die einen umfassenden Schutz für Ihre Cloud-Server bieten, erstellen täglich um 00:00 Uhr einen Snapshot, basierend auf dem Standort des Rechenzentrums.

Kamatera bietet außerdem hochentwickelte Disaster-Recovery-Lösungen, darunter eine Echtzeit-Datenreplikation rund um die Uhr, die sicherstellt, dass eine aktuelle Version Ihrer Datenbank jederzeit für eine sofortige Wiederherstellung verfügbar ist.

Wie handhabe ich Sicherheit und Firewalls bei einem GitLab-VPS auf Kamatera?

Kamatera bietet eine Cloud-Firewall, mit der Sie den Zugriff auf Ihre GitLab-Instanz einschränken können. Sie können auch bestimmte IP-Adressen auf eine Whitelist setzen, ein VPN einrichten und sicherstellen, dass sensible Ports (wie SSH- und Admin-Ports) nicht für das öffentliche Internet zugänglich sind.

Was sind die wichtigsten Anwendungsfälle für GitLab?

Die meisten Teams nutzen GitLab auf Kamatera, um ihren gesamten DevOps-Lebenszyklus zu zentralisieren. Die häufigsten Anwendungsfälle sind:
Konsolidierung von Toolchains: Ersetzen mehrerer separater Tools (Jira, Jenkins und Bitbucket) durch eine integrierte Plattform.
Sichere interne Entwicklung: Schaffung einer geschützten Umgebung für internen Code, der aufgrund strenger Compliance- oder Urheberrechtsbestimmungen nicht in öffentlichen Clouds gehostet werden kann.
Automatisierte Tests und Bereitstellung: Einsatz von GitLab Runners auf Kamatera zur Beschleunigung der Build-Zeiten und Sicherstellung der Codequalität vor der Produktion.
Aufbau einer privaten Registry: Sichere Speicherung proprietärer Docker-Images im eigenen Unternehmensnetzwerk.

Was sind die gängigsten Alternativen zu GitLab?

Zu den beliebtesten Alternativen zählen GitHub, Bitbucket und Gitea. GitHub ist der Branchenführer für Open Source und Social Coding und bietet umfangreiche Integrationen von Drittanbietern. Bitbucket, Teil der Atlassian-Suite, wird häufig von Teams bevorzugt, die bereits Jira und Confluence verwenden. Gitea ist eine leichtgewichtige, selbst gehostete Option, die eine einfache Git-Schnittstelle mit deutlich geringeren Hardwareanforderungen als GitLab bietet.

Welche Zahlungsarten werden akzeptiert?

Unser System akzeptiert Kredit-/Debitkarten, die von Ihrer örtlichen Bankfiliale auf den Namen des Karteninhabers ausgestellt werden. Wir akzeptieren auch Zahlungen über PayPal.

Kann ich die Infrastruktur von Kamatera kostenlos testen?

Kamatera bietet eine kostenlose 30-tägige Testphase. Diese kostenlose Testversion bietet Dienste im Wert von bis zu 100 US-Dollar. Nach der Anmeldung können Sie über die Verwaltungskonsole einen Server bereitstellen und unsere Infrastruktur testen. Sie können ein Rechenzentrum, ein Betriebssystem, CPU, RAM, Speicher und andere Systemeinstellungen auswählen.